We provide educational resources and personalized support to help investors at every stage of their journey. Oxford Lane Capital Corp. (OXLCZ) has released its financial results for the fourth quarter of 2025, with the company reporting earnings per share of $2.55. As a business development company specializing in investments in senior secured loans and other debt instruments, Oxford Lane Capital continues to navigate the evolving fixed-income landscape while delivering income to shareholders.
